  • Responsibilities

    RISE Literacy works to boost learning for students entering first grade through third grade. Literacy Tutors will be aligned to work with small groups (5 - 6) of children at a time to improve their reading skills. Hours will depend on which programs and tutor’s preference.

    Are you looking for an opportunity to make an IMPACT on the next generation? If so, we are looking for you to join our TEAM!!

    Purpose Statement:

    The major responsibility will be to conduct literacy sessions with small groups of students using pre-defined lesson plans that are fully scripted with small groups of K–3 students. Lessons will include activities such as reading aloud to students, helping students learn vocabulary, conducting writing exercises with students, and doing literacy games with kids.
